    As an electronic manufacturing services (EMS) provider for the commercial aerospace, defense, medical device, life science, and industrial markets, we work to deliver products of the highest quality and reliability.


    Our organization provides comprehensive contract manufacturing services, ranging from printed circuit board assembly (PCBA) and subsystem integration to full-box build (high-level assemblies).

    Additional services include engineering support such as manufacturing testing, supply chain management, sustaining engineering, and a suite of aftermarket services to support the full OEM product lifecycle.

    With over $500 million in revenue, approximately 1,700 dedicated employees, and manufacturing resources strategically located worldwide, our manufacturing network spans the United States and Vietnam.

    In this role you will perform specialized or diversified procurement functions required supply material in accordance with Corporate Polices and Procedures; using the lowest reasonable price, ensuring the maximum quality goods delivered on-time to support manufacturing.

    Place purchase orders as needed. Follow-up on purchase orders, Supplier contracts and material status as required.
    Resolve Supplier quality issues, purchase order accounting issues and problem receipts.

    Travel, as required, to meet with Suppliers and other appropriate representatives to discuss and satisfy matters that cannot be taken care of in the plant.

    May be responsible for determining material requirements from engineering and production schedules and maintaining inventory at appropriate level.

    Generally, will exercise judgment within defined procedures and practices to determine appropriate actions in line with company policies of good, ethical purchasing practices.

    Prepare management and analysis reports on a weekly, monthly and quarterly basis.
    Perform other related duties as necessary to support the Corporate Commodity and Logistics Group.

    BA/BS in related field or equivalent experience
    Thorough understanding of operations principles (JIT, MRP, TQC, and CRP) required.
